Wisconsin bear hunters see a big rebound in harvest from poor 2023 season
A preliminary 2024 black bear harvest of 4,285 animals during Wisconsin’s five-week season represents a substantial rebound from a below-average 2023 harvest of 2,922 bears registered last season.
